HKCU\Control Panel\Desktop\AutoEndTasks=1

Hi All,

I am told on another forum that this key:

H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Control Panel\Desktop\AutoEndTasks=1

is suppose to end all tasks and log off all users on XP shutdown.
I know it ends all tasks, but I was unaware that is also
logged off all users. Can anyone verify this for me?

Re: HKCU\Control Panel\Desktop\AutoEndTasks=1

It ends a task when a user logs off or shutdown. It does not logoff the
user.
